Jamaica Customs working with Gov’t to prevent individuals from diverting funds from nation’s coffers

The Jamaica Customs Agency (JCA) says it is working with the Finance Ministry to obstruct the efforts of individuals who wish to divert funds from the nation’s coffers.
Speaking with IRIE FM News, JCA’s Acting Chief Executive Officer, Dr. Kirk Benjamin, says while the agency is not only preoccupied with revenue collections, its importance cannot be ignored.
Dr. Benjamin notes that the JCA will not relent in its efforts to plug all possible loopholes, including those relating to false declarations.
He said the funds collected are used to help with nation-building.
